On Thu, 2014-07-24 at 06:13 -0700, Jeff Kirsher wrote:
> From: Shannon Nelson <shannon.nelson@intel.com>
> 
> Sometimes the AQTX answer comes back with no data, but we still want to print
> the descriptor that got written back.

Maybe this does some reads from buffer beyond its size
in i40e_debug_aq?  Is that always safe?

> di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_adminq.c b/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_adminq.c
[]
> @@ -889,11 +889,9 @@ i40e_status i40e_asq_send_command(struct i40e_hw *hw,
>  		hw->aq.asq_last_status = (enum i40e_admin_queue_err)retval;
>  	}
>  
> -	if (le16_to_cpu(desc->datalen) == buff_size) {
> -		i40e_debug(hw, I40E_DEBUG_AQ_MESSAGE,
> -			   "AQTX: desc and buffer writeback:\n");
> -		i40e_debug_aq(hw, I40E_DEBUG_AQ_COMMAND, (void *)desc, buff);
> -	}
> +	i40e_debug(hw, I40E_DEBUG_AQ_MESSAGE,
> +		   "AQTX: desc and buffer writeback:\n");
> +	i40e_debug_aq(hw, I40E_DEBUG_AQ_COMMAND, (void *)desc, buff);


void i40e_debug_aq(struct i40e_hw *hw, enum i40e_debug_mask mask, void *desc,
		   void *buffer)
{
	struct i40e_aq_desc *aq_desc = (struct i40e_aq_desc *)desc;
	u8 *aq_buffer = (u8 *)buffer;
[]
		for (i = 0; i < le16_to_cpu(aq_desc->datalen); i++) {
			data[((i % 16) / 4)] |=
				((u32)aq_buffer[i]) << (8 * (i % 4));
			if ((i % 16) == 15) {
				i40e_debug(hw, mask,
					   "\t0x%04X  %08X %08X %08X %08X\n",
					   i - 15, data[0], data[1], data[2],
					   data[3]);
				memset(data, 0, sizeof(data));
			}
